Kuna, Idaho, known as the "Gateway to the Birds of Prey" conservation area, is a rapidly growing community in Ada County just 20 minutes southwest of Boise. With a population exceeding 25,000 residents, Kuna has evolved from its agricultural roots into a thriving suburban city while maintaining its small-town charm and community values. The city's semi-arid high desert climate in USDA Zone 6a presents unique challenges for lawn care and landscaping. Hot, dry summers with temperatures regularly exceeding 95°F combined with cold winters that can drop below zero create demanding conditions for turf grass. The predominant clay soil throughout Kuna neighborhoods like Crimson Point, Indian Creek, and Teed Farms requires specialized lawn care approaches including regular aeration, proper soil amendments, and carefully managed irrigation to maintain healthy lawns. Lawn Care Considerations in Kuna

Kuna's heavy clay soil requires annual core aeration in fall, bi-annual fertilization (spring and fall), and proper irrigation management during hot summers. Most lawns are Kentucky bluegrass that benefits from maintaining 3-3.5 inch height during peak summer heat. Fall is ideal for overseeding and renovation projects. Sprinkler systems should be winterized by early November before first hard freeze. New construction areas around Teed Farms and Indian Creek often have severely compacted soil requiring additional aeration and soil amendments.
